The violet was first discovered by the German governor of the German colony in East Africa, in the region of Uzambara mountains in 1892. Avoiding the heat, strolling with their companion, they turned into the forest, where there was a good shadow. There he saw beautiful flowers.

violet chateau brion
He sent the seeds home to his father Ulrich Saint-Paul, who was fond of floriculture and collecting orchids. He passed the seeds to his friend - the director of the botanical garden. Herman Wendland gave the name to the violet in honor of the family of Saint-Paul, and thus the plant was named "Saintpaulia".

Acquaintance of the world with Saintpaulia

In 1893, the senpolia was presented at the international exhibition of gardeners; its description was published by the Gartenflora magazine. Since then, this plant has become a common perennial indoor flower in Europe, and a little later around the world. Violet came to the territory of Russia in the XX century, and began its path of distribution from the Leningrad Botanical Garden.

The senpolia received its second name in honor of the place of her birth, "Uzumbar violet." This name is often found in everyday life. One of the most beautiful and unusual species of the Uzumbar variety is violet chateau brion.

Conditions of detention

Violet can grow both in the light and in the semi-shaded corners of the house. Most often, of course, you can find violets on the windowsill. But do not forget about the main rule of keeping the senpolis, which is to provide a large amount of light, but not the sun.

It is worth remembering that the plant does not like drying out, which means that it needs regular watering. But in no case should you spray the petals, this will lead to the death of the plant.

The temperature regime for violets is just as important as watering. The necessary temperature favorable for the growth of senpolia is 22-25 Β° C during the day and up to 19 Β° C at night.

To provide better care and good living conditions, violets need organic and mineral fertilizers.

Like any houseplant, violet needs constant care, because in addition to various diseases, the plant can be attacked by pests. The most dangerous for the senpolia are thrips. They can go into the soil, can be on the leaves of a flower. When they appear, timely treatment of the plant with special preparations is necessary.

The propagation of the senpolia

Propagated by violet chateau brion, like all varieties of violets, cuttings and seeds. Most often they are cut. The most favorable time for this is, of course, spring.

Although for breeders and experienced gardeners, the time of year does not matter. Before breaking the stem from an adult plant, it is necessary to water the flower itself. Then, having broken off the leaf, it is lowered into the water and the violet stalk is kept on the windowsill or shelving until the roots hatch. After which the stalk is simply planted in the ground.

From seeds, plants grow stronger. But for germination of seeds special conditions are necessary (temperature, humidity, lighting).

Racks for growing and breeding

racks for violets

Racks for violets are used often enough, especially if there are a lot of plants. For the senpolia, shelves are needed, the sizes of which must be selected according to the possibility of placing lighting lamps. For example, a shelf up to 40 cm wide can be illuminated with a single lamp, and having more than 40 cm, this amount of lighting will no longer be enough.

Shelvings for violets are very convenient in operation, there you can not only contain plants, but also breed new young ones. Now there are no problems with the choice of shelving. There is an opportunity to buy ready-made, assembled or made to order sizes, you can also order parts and assemble it yourself.

Everything will depend on the number of plants placed on it. And, of course, you need to remember about the proper lighting on the shelves of the rack.

Violet chateau brion: description

There are a huge number of senpolis, many of them are very similar. So, violet chateau brion, the description of which we offer to your attention, will decorate any windowsill and shelving. Flowering of this type of plant is plentiful, cap-like.

This plant has powerful peduncles, they are erect, dense, pubescent and are always located vertically. The leaf is deep green, slightly elongated and slightly wavy. The flower itself is terry, toward the edge the petals are noticeably thickened, and have a light green or white color. The shape of the flower is round - about 6 cm in diameter. One of the distinguishing features of this variety is the color of the plant, namely dark wine-ruby flowers with a dense wavy border of white or greenish color along the corrugated edge of the petal. The flower outlet looks like a pompom and blooms profusely and for a long time.

The described violets are quite unpretentious and tenacious - this variety does not require special, exclusive care. It is necessary to contain the flower in the same way as other varieties of Uzumbar violets.

A bit about the creator of the variety

Violet chateau brion is a variety bred by Elena Lebetskoy. She is a representative of breeders of Ukraine, lives in Vinnitsa and has been breeding new varieties since 2000. All flowers obtained as a result of Lebetskaya selection in the name have the prefix β€œLE”, such as violet le chΓ’teau brion.

By the way, until that time, Elena was engaged in collecting plants and the usual cultivation of violets. But, to date, she has on her account about 250 varieties of Uzumbar violets bred by her. And each of them is unique and striking in its beauty to thousands of lovers of this beautiful indoor flower.
